    Quote Originally Posted by Edge- View Post
    It's sorta got one now, though. Between the "tank" that's stacking vit to control aggro on the boss and the fact that there's very much a "healer" role in HoT, Anet took what was a very soft trinity in the base game of control/damage/support and firmed it up into something that's much closer to what folks expect out of a proper trinity.
    You stack toughness to control aggro not vit

    I honestly like how it's a loose trinity currently. There is a lot of flexibility in what people can bring and do and be successful in the raid wings. I'm really looking forward to being able to switch builds on the fly much easier once legendary armor is done and at that point I think a lot of the strengths of the current system will start to shine. People who have the ability to play their characters in multiple ways instead of just one will be really valuable.
